Barcelona agreed a deal with Brazilian club Gremio for the ‘purchase option’ of Arthur Henrique Ramos de Oliveira Melo, simply known as Arthur, in March.

The Catalan club have an option to bring the midfielder to Camp Nou in July 2018. If they exercise the option, it will cost them €30m plus €9 million in variables. Mundo Deportivo claims the La Liga winners are planning to complete his move this summer.

Xavi Hernandez and Andres Iniesta were instrumental in Barcelona’s midfield, when they dominated in Spain and Europe. The Spanish duo have have left the club and the Blaugrana are yet to find their replacements.

Arthur impressed in the seven matches he played for Gremio in the Brasileirao. His average pass percentage is 94.3% and never dropped below 90% in those fixtures. The report hails the Brazilian as ‘the king of the pass’, and Mundo Deportivo seem very impressed indeed.

Spanish champions Barca are now relying on Arthur, but they are aware of the quality gap between the Brazilian league and La Liga, which according to Mundo Deportivo is the best league in the world.

Since returning from a recent injury, there has not been a dip in Arthur’s form. Mundo have also collected the pass percentages of individual matches the midfielder has played in Brasileirao.

They are highlighting how good Arthur has been for Gremio. Keeping in the mind the time one needs to adjust to the European football, there is a growing belief at Barcelona that he could be successful at the club.

Arthur will also come with a increased pressure, as he would be expected to fulfill the void left by Iniesta’s departure. If he manages to maintain his pass percentage above 90%, he should be appreciated at the Camp Nou.
